Texas is about 6 times bigger than New York.
New York is approximately 122,283 sq km,
while Texas is approximately 678,052 sq km, making
Texas 454% larger than New York.
Meanwhile, the population of New York is ~19.4 million people
(5.8 million more people live in Texas).
